Anti-Ragging Committee

Establishment of Anti Ragging Committee(As per All India Council for Technical Education notified regulation for prevention and prohibition of ragging in AICTE approved technical Institutions vide No. 37-3/Legal/AICTE/2009 dated 01.07.2009)

AIM: Prevention and prohibition of Ragging in technical Institutions, Universities including Deemed to be Universities imparting technical education.

ANTI-RAGGING COMMITTEE    

Every Institution University including Deemed to be University imparting technical education shall constitute a Committee to be known as the Antiragging Committee to be nominated and headed by the Head of the Institution, and consisting of representatives of civil and police administration, local media, Non-Government Organizations involved in youth activities, representatives of faculty members, representatives of parents, representatives of students belonging to the fresher’s category as well as senior students, non-teaching staff; and shall have a diverse mix of membership in terms of level as well as gender.

Anti Ragging Squad

Every Institution University including Deemed to be University imparting technical education shall also constitute a smaller body to be known as the AntiRagging Squad to be nominated by the Head of the Institution with such representation as may be considered necessary for maintaining vigil, oversight and patrolling functions and shall remain mobile, alert and active at all times. Provided that the Anti-Ragging Squad shall have representation of various members of the campus community and shall have no outside representation.

Internal Quality Assurance Cell

IQAC shall evolve mechanisms and procedures for:

  1. Ensuring timely, efficient and progressive performance of academic, administrative and financial tasks.
    2. Ensure relevance and quality of academic and research programmes.
    3. Equitable access to and affordability of academic programmes for various sections of society.
    4. Optimization and integration of modern methods of teaching and learning.
    5. Setup credibility of evaluation procedures.
    6. Ensuring the adequacy, maintenance and functioning of the support structure and services.
    7. Research sharing and networking with other institutions in India and abroad.

 

Functions:

Some of the functions expected of the IQAC are:

  1. Development and application of quality benchmarks/parameters for the various academic and administrative activities of the institution.
    2. Dissemination of information on the various quality parameters of higher education.
    Organization of workshops, seminars on quality related themes.
  2. Documentation of the various programmes / activities leading to quality improvement.
    2. Acting as a nodal agency of the institution for quality-related activities.
    3. Preparation of the Annual Quality Assurance Report (AQAR) to be submitted to NAAC based on the quality parameters.

Benefits:

IQAC will facilitate / contribute:

To a heightened level of clarity and focus in institutional functioning towards quality enhancement and facilitate internalization of the quality culture for Quality and Excellence in Higher Education.
2. Enhancement and integration among the various activities of the institution and institutionalize of many good practices.
3. To provide a sound basis for decision making to improve institutional functioning.
4. To act as a change agent in the institution.
5. For better internal communication.

SC/ST Committee

Establishment of Committee for SC/ST (As per the Scheduled Castes and the Scheduled Tribes (prevention of Atrocities) act, 1989, No. 33 of 1989, dated 11.09.1989)

AIM: The Scheduled Caste (SC) and Scheduled Tribes (ST) Cell in an institute promotes the special interests of students in the reserved category. It is expected to provide special inputs in areas where the students experience difficulties.

ASSOCIATED ACTIVITIES:

The Cell may conduct regular remedial coaching classes on life skills, personality development, writing assignments and making presentations, as well as English and local language classes. The Cell also is expected to organize interactive sessions and informal meetings with students to attend to their personal, social and academic problems. Guide the SC/ST/OBC/PWD students of the Institute, to optimally utilize the benefits of the schemes offered by the State Governments, Government of India (GOI) and UGC.

Student Counseling Cell

Counseling is a process that aims to facilitate personal well being of the students through support and guidance of trained counselors, for a healthy mind and body.

With the intent to address and help resolve emotional and psychological issues of the student community of SMVITM, the college has initiated the “Counseling Cell” in the college premises with the help of a trained team of faculty members as Counselors.

The Counseling Cell encourages the students to understand themselves and the issues that trouble them and guides them to resolve their problems. These problems can be personal, emotional, social, family, peer, academic, sexual, etc. This is done through individual or group counselling to help them with academic goals, social and personality development, career goals, enhancing listening skills, empathy and interpersonal skills to have healthy relationships and a healthy lifestyle.

The role of the Counselor is to offer support through listening and responding in a confidential, non-judgemental and timely way, ensuring that the students become productive, well adjusted adults of tomorrow. They are trained to assess, diagnose and treat students struggling with academic stress, anxiety, depression, social addictions and other problems they face.

The goal of Counseling is to facilitate positive behavior changes, improving the student’s ability to establish and maintain relationships socially, promoting their decision making process, helping the student to understand their own potential and cope effectively with the problems they face.

Objectives:

  • To help the students in solving their personal, educational, social as well as psychological problems.
  • To create awareness about issues and problems related to mental health of student
  • To motivate faculty in counselling activities.

Roles and Responsibilities

  • Solve personal problems of student by conducting individual counselling session
  • Boost self esteem of weaker /physically challenged students.
  • Diagnose the learning difficulties of students and help them to overcome the same.
  • Help the students to overcome examination stress or fear.
  • Conduct training program on counselling skills for faculty & staff.
  • Conduct seminars for students on mental health and addiction issues.
  • Refer the students to professional psychiatrics or counsellors in severe cases.
  • Inform the parents about psychological misbehaviour of the student.

JCE Belagavi is committed to providing safe academic and working environment to all students and its women employees. As per the guidelines of Supreme Court, UGC, Sexual Harassment of Women at Workplace (Prevention, Prohibition & Redressal) Act, 2013, an Internal Complaints Committee has been established by the College for a period of three years.

Objectives:

The objectives of the Internal Complaint Committee to Prevent Sexual Harassment of Women at the Workplace are as follows:

  1. To develop a policy against sexual harassment of women at the Institute.
  2. To evolve a permanent mechanism for the prevention and redressal of sexual harassment cases and other acts of gender-based violence at the Institute.
  3. To ensure the implementation of the policy in letter and spirit through proper reporting of the complaints and their follow-up procedures.
  4. To uphold the commitment of the Institute to provide an environment free of gender-based discrimination.
  5. To create a secure physical and social environment to deter any act of sexual harassment.
  6. To promote a social and psychological environment to raise awareness on sexual harassment in its various forms.
Grievance Redressal Cell

AIM: In order to ensure transparency by Technical institutions imparting technical education, in admissions and with Paramount Objective of preventing unfair practices and to provide a mechanism to innocent students for redressal of their grievances.

The Statutory Committee Grievance Redressal Committee (GRC) is formed as per Clause 1 of section 23 of the AICTE Act, 1987 (52 of 1987) AICTE. The Committee has been formed in order to ensure transparency by technical institutions imparting technical education in admissions, preventing unfair practices, complaints of alleged discrimination by students of Scheduled Caste, Scheduled Tribe, OBC, Women, Minority or Disabled Categories, scholarship issues and sexual harassment and to provide a mechanism to innocent students and stakeholders for redressal of their grievances.

Procedure:

The person concerned with any grievance shall fill the Grievance Redressal Form with all possible facts and documentation and submit it to the Principal’s office or online. The committee will investigate into the matter and shall try to resolve it as quickly as possible.

Scope

  1. Formation of grievance redressal cells to handle grievances.
  2. Redress students’, staff and faculty grievances separately
  3. Redress girl students’, lady staff and faculty grievances separately.
  4. A separate cell for ladies.
  5. Suitable timings for students’, staff and faculty.
  6. Redress grievances promptly.
  7. To let employees present their issues without prejudging or commenting
  8. Use positive, friendly ways to resolve the crisis than punitive steps, which disturb the system.
  9. Reassure them that the authorities will be acting impartially and will try to resolve the matter as amicably as possible.
  10. Ensure effective, sensitive and confidential communication between all involved
  11. Ensure that there is proper investigation of the facts and figures related the problem
